Title: Problems with LuminAudio - LedWiz
Post by: morebeer on July 03, 2008, 09:23:42 pm
Howdy all... I picked up 2 LEDWiz's and 16 of the Electric Ice buttons and RGB LEDs from GGG - Totally awesome...  I've got 8 of the buttons and 1 LedWiz in, and I'm using GameEx w/ HeadKaze's amazing LED/LCD plugin.  I've gotten everything to work so far, except LuminAudio.  The LuminAudio app correctly identifies my soundcard, I highlight the blue '1' for my first LedWiz, and click 'Start Output'... my buttons do an initial flash of blue, but that is it.  I've checked my mixer, and tried different sound apps (VLC, Windows Media Player, etc...), but no buttons ever light up.  I even disabled the motherboard's onboard AC97 and tried an older PCI SB Live... Music plays fine, but LuminAudio doesn't seem to be able to pick up the audio.

Title: Re: Problems with LuminAudio - LedWiz
Post by: headkaze on July 03, 2008, 10:27:07 pm
Run the SndVol32 application (Start->Run enter "SndVol32" then enter).

Once the volume control app comes up select Options->Properties then select the "Recording" radio button.

Now you have to select your input device as "Stereo Mix" or "Mix Out" something along those lines. Have LuminAudio running along with some music playing while you adjust the volume controls to get the right levels.
